Historic Bitcoin Rally Follows Regulatory Shift Announcement
Cryptocurrency markets experienced volatile trading this week following former President Donald Trump's nomination of pro-crypto advocate Paul Atkins as SEC Chairman. Bitcoin achieved a historic milestone, breaking the $100,000 barrier** for the first time with a **7% 24-hour gain**, while total crypto market capitalization reached **$2.1 trillion.
Key Market Developments:
- Bitcoin price movement: $94,600 → $103,000 (+7.66%)
- Altcoin performance: Ethereum (+5%), Dogecoin (+9%)
- Market reaction: Over $600M in liquidations affecting 210K traders
Trump's SEC Nomination Signals Policy Shift
The December 4th announcement positions Atkins—a known cryptocurrency supporter—to potentially reverse current SEC policies:
🔹 Regulatory Philosophy: Advocates reduced crypto oversight
🔹 Enforcement Approach: Critical of "overreach" harming innovation
🔹 Pending Cases: May dismiss actions against Coinbase and others

Industry Reactions:
- Travis Kling (Ikigai Asset Management): "The ideal SEC Chair for crypto with clear pro-innovation mandate"
- Investment Company Institute: Praised Atkins' "extensive industry experience"
- Senator Rick Scott (R-SC): Supports looser IPO rules and crypto-friendly policies

Future Outlook
With Fed Chair Powell comparing Bitcoin to "digital gold" rather than a dollar competitor, and political support growing for US Bitcoin reserves, analysts predict continued institutional adoption. The nomination process will be closely watched, as Atkins' confirmation could mark a watershed moment for US crypto policy.
